What a Force Field Looks Like
A force field is a semi-transparent energy barrier, usually glowing and slightly distorting what’s behind it. It shimmers with energy, ripples when struck, and often has a geometric or hexagonal pattern suggesting structured energy.
The defining qualities are translucency, a glowing edge, subtle distortion, and reactive ripples on impact. Recreating these — a faint energy surface that bends light and reacts to hits — is what makes a force field read as a powerful protective barrier.

Create the Barrier Shape
Start with the field’s shape — a sphere, dome, wall, or bubble. Building a shape or solid in the form of the barrier, made semi-transparent, establishes the energy surface the rest of the effect builds on.
The shape defines where the field is, often a translucent dome or sphere around a subject. Keeping it semi-transparent so the scene shows through, while suggesting a curved energy surface, creates the foundation of the protective barrier.

Add a Glow and Edge
Energy fields glow, especially at their edges. Adding a glow and a brighter rim to the barrier makes it radiate energy, with the edge often more intense where the field curves away from the viewer.
This glowing edge is key to the energy look, suggesting the field is brightest at its boundary. A colored glow — blue, cyan, or any energy hue — radiating from the barrier’s surface and edge gives it the luminous, powered quality of a force field.

Add a Pattern
Many force fields have a structured pattern. Adding a hexagonal, grid, or geometric texture to the barrier, faintly visible, suggests engineered energy and adds the high-tech detail seen in sci-fi shields.
This pattern, kept subtle and following the barrier’s curve, reinforces the technological feel. A faint hexagonal grid is a classic choice, implying the field is made of interlocking energy cells, which adds believability and detail to the shield.

Add Distortion
A force field bends the light passing through it. Adding subtle distortion to the area behind the barrier makes what’s seen through it shimmer and warp slightly, selling the idea of an energy surface affecting light.
This refraction, even if subtle, is what makes the field feel like a real energy barrier rather than a flat overlay. Distorting the background within the field’s shape, animated gently, gives the force field a tangible, light-bending presence.
Animate Impact Ripples
The most dynamic moment is when something strikes the field. Animating a ripple or flash spreading from the point of impact, with the barrier brightening and distorting more, shows the field absorbing or deflecting an attack.
These impact reactions bring the force field to life dramatically. A bright ripple radiating from where a projectile hits, timed to the impact, demonstrates the field’s power and makes the protective barrier feel active and responsive.
Animate the Energy
A static field looks lifeless, so add constant subtle motion. Animating the glow pulsing, the pattern shifting, or energy flowing across the surface gives the force field a living, powered quality even when nothing is striking it.
This continuous animation, using techniques like wiggle on the glow or a drifting pattern, suggests the field is actively generating energy. The subtle, ongoing movement is what makes the barrier feel powered and alive rather than a frozen graphic.

A Real Force Field Example
Imagine a hero raising a glowing dome shield as projectiles rain down. You build a translucent blue sphere around them, add a bright glowing edge and a faint hexagonal pattern that follows its curve, and subtly distort the background seen through it so it shimmers like energy. A gentle pulse keeps it alive even at rest.
Then, as each projectile strikes, you animate a bright ripple radiating from the impact point while the field flares and distorts harder. The shield reads as a powerful, living energy barrier absorbing the attack — exactly the combination of translucency, glow, refraction, and reactive ripples that makes a force field convincing.
Force Fields and Their Surroundings
A convincing force field affects more than itself — it casts colored light on nearby surfaces and the subject inside it, especially in darker scenes. Adding a faint wash of the field’s color onto the protected character and the ground grounds the barrier in the scene rather than floating it on top.
On impact, that cast light should flare brighter momentarily, reinforcing the energy release. Accounting for how the field interacts with its environment, alongside the glow and distortion on the barrier itself, is the detail that separates an integrated, believable shield from an obvious overlay.
Animate the Field On and Off
A force field is most dramatic when it powers up and down rather than simply existing. Animating the barrier forming — expanding outward from a point or assembling from its hexagonal pattern as it activates — gives it a satisfying, powered entrance, and reversing that for shutdown.
Timing these activations to the character’s action and a powering-up sound, using our keyframe easing, sells the technology. A field that snaps into being to block an attack, then fades once the threat passes, feels far more dynamic and intentional than one that’s always on.
